Alvin J. Howell 1930 - 2009 Lawrence
A memorial service for Alvin J. Howell, 78, Lawrence, will be held at 10 a.m. Thursday at Warren-McElwain Mortuary. Inurnment will follow at Memorial Park Cemetery.
Mr. Howell died Monday, Oct. 12, 2009, at Lawrence Memorial Hospital.
He was born Nov. 23, 1930, in El Dorado, the son of Allen and Genevieve Tipton Howell.
Mr. Howell was a graduate of El Dorado High School. He served in the U.S. Air Force and was a Korean War veteran. He received an honorable discharge.
In 1965, he received his bachelor’s degree in commercial art from Kansas University. Mr. Howell worked for Bell Telephone in Topeka from 1965 until 1968. From 1968 to 1973, he worked at Curtis 1000 in Lawrence. Mr. Howell was a professional illustrator and in 1973 he opened Howell Creative Studio.
Mr. Howell was a member of Travelers Protective Association and participated in its Adopt-a-Family program each Christmas. He was a life member of the Elks Lodge in Ottawa, as well as a member of the American Legion Dorsey-Liberty Post 14 and the Eagles Lodge in Lawrence. Mr. Howell was a member of Junkyard Jazz. He earned his private pilot license and was an avid flier. He also loved photography.
He married Georgia Edith Kermoade on May 24, 1954, in Ottawa. She survives, of the home.
Other survivors include his sister, Ruthetta Foss, Commerce, Okla.
